In summary

Andover South is in the least-deprived 10–20% of England, ranked #821 of 6,856 neighbourhoods nationally, and #5 of 17 in Test Valley. Across the seven themes it scores highest on Housing & access (89) and lowest on Crime (65). Typical homes here sold for about £319,500 over the past year, up 19% across five years (from 118 sales), 12% below the wider Test Valley median of £361,250.
